Responsibilities

  • Serve as a primary client-facing manager delivering technical work products and on-site representation while coordinating documentation, cost control, and time management.
  • Lead the project’s technical effort, provide guidance to the team, and coordinate with project entities to meet schedule and budget targets.
  • Act as a key liaison between the owner and general contractors on specialized, multi-disciplined projects and support decision-making through well-founded recommendations.
  • Represent MBP with professionalism in meetings and client interactions while supporting strategic objectives across assignments.
  • Coordinate and track multiple project activities on concurrent projects and determine staffing requirements to support adequate coverage.
  • Liaise between the Owner and General Contractors on specialized, multi-disciplined construction projects, including job site construction inspection.
  • Plan, organize, coordinate, direct, and manage multi‑disciplinary work efforts; oversee validation of products and materials ordered for projects to verify conformance to specifications.
  • Monitor and assess construction performance and record construction activities to verify compliance with construction documentation requirements.
  • Inspect work in progress to verify that methods, materials, and equipment conform to approved standards.
  • Maintain project documentation by reviewing Construction Inspectors’ daily status reports; chart progress of contract schedules via scheduled meetings; review and coordinate shop drawing submittals; process and facilitate incorporation of RFIs; review contractor change orders, make recommendations, and incorporate approved changes into the project record.
  • Facilitate regularly scheduled construction meetings.
  • Assist in training and provide technical guidance to Construction Inspectors.
  • Review punch lists submitted by others and verify completion and correction of items prior to recommending substantial completion to the Owner.
